Output 433f91ae36147d5c8ed5306d5ce767920211ca6aa2c4f13606d1c10bf28c140f:0

value
375607864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c3f4ec48f43a8799d5223c3ae09776ad526402 OP_EQUAL
address
3Q1DYfPa59NZUB1QUg4Jzx6pBG1mQFZWen
transaction
433f91ae36147d5c8ed5306d5ce767920211ca6aa2c4f13606d1c10bf28c140f
spent
true